Towards a Cloud-Based Controller for Data-Driven Service Orchestration in Smart Manufacturing

Description

The orchestration of smart manufacturing service operations and processes arises as a challenging step in the realization of the Industry 4.0 vision. This paper presents the work in progress towards the specifications of a controlling environment for data-driven orchestration of software services in future smart manufacturing scenarios. The paper discusses the role and significance of multi-aspect data in the management of manufacturing operations and proposes a reference architecture for controlling the orchestration of the respective data services, following the work that has been conducted in the context of the EU-funded project DISRUPT.
